Doesn't really matter whether the points are needed to get a train in/out of a T3 or not because we won't necessarily know where trains will be entering or exiting when a possession is taken. When a train turns up to enter the possession the signal will be passed at danger anyway so you'd set the points according to the route card (with the PICOP's permission if you're moving points within the possession as people could be working on them for all I know) and you're done! As soon as the PICOP confirms the train is clear and the protection has been replaced you'd replace your points back into the position to protect the possession. (There's a lot more to it than that but that's the simple version ref points!)
We have "reminder appliances" yes - these take different forms depending on what kind of signalling system is in use (VDU/panel/lever frame etc...) For a panel (which Wimbledon SCC is) they're plastic 'caps' that go over the route buttons/point switches that physically stop you pushing them and setting routes or swinging points. For a VDU system (computer based) they work in exactly the same way but they are software based.
